Duration: The alarm will only be recorded if the duration of the parameter meeting
the threshold criteria exceeds the duration. The minimum alarm duration can be
in minutes or seconds. In the case of Vrms or Arms not using neutral current, can
also be in hundredths of a second.
For Vrms and Arms, it can be useful to set a duration of 0 seconds. In that case
an event as short as a half cycle can be detected (8 milliseconds at 60Hz). For all
other parameters, the minimum duration that can be detected is 1 second.
NOTE: It is possible to check for alarms, records and search for transients at the
same time.

Recordings Configuration

The Recording window shows the dialog box used to configure the parameters for
a recording session.
Four different configurations are available. More configurations can be saved by
pressing "Save to File" and recalled later by pressing "Load From File".
1.
Check the configuration you wish to set up: 1, 2, 3 or 4.
